Leukotriene Antagonist LEUKOTRIENE ANTAGONIST Are also referred as “Leukotriene Receptor Antagonists” (LTRA’s). Non-steroidal anti-inflammatory bronchoconstriction preventors.  Work by blocking inflammatory reactions in airways. MECHANISM OF ACTION: Two main approaches to block leukotrienes actions: Inhibition of 5-lipoxygenase pathway Drugs inhibiting 5-lipoxygenase enzyme will inhibit synthetic pathway of leukotriene metabolism MK-886 – Blocks 5-lipoxygenase activating protein (FLAP), inhibiting 5-lipoxygenase enzyme functioning & helps in treating atherosclerosis.
